Inspired by a true friendship, the film is set in 1962 and follows (Viggo Mortensen), a rough-around-the-edges Italian-American bouncer from the Bronx. When his nightclub closes for renovations, he takes a job as a driver for Dr. Don Shirley (Mahershala Ali), a world-class African-American classical pianist.
